Background: This study aimed to reveal the anatomical variation in the great auricular nerve (CAN) and the correlation between the size of the CAN and the facial nerve trunk (FNT), so as to aid surgeons to perform safe facelift surgery and patotidectomy. Methods: Sixteen human cadavers were studied on 16 left and 15 right facial sides. The GAN's branching patterns, location, and the mean width of the GAN and FNT were measured. Results: The average distance where the nerve emerged from under the sternocleidomastoid muscle was 87.61 +/- 12.13 mm when measured perpendicular to the Frankfort horizontal plane. The branching pattern of the GAN could be classified into 7 types of which the most common was type 3 (30.77%), where the CAN divided into the anterior (superficial) and posterior branches, and then the deep branch originated from the posterior branch of the CAN. The mean width of the CAN and FNT from all the dissections was 3.26 +/- 0.67mm and 3.36 +/- 0.71 mm, respectively. There was a significant correlation between the width of the nerves on both facial sides (right: r =0.710, P=0.002; left: r = 0.839, P< 0.001). Conclusions: This study revealed the anatomical variation and the width of the GAN, which can strongly piedict the width of the FNT. This should be taken into consideration during facelift surgery and parotidectomy, especially in patients with a small CAN to prevent iatrogenic injury to the small FNT.
